Сплит (или «разделение») — это одна из самых полезных функций, которую можно использовать в программировании. Она позволяет разделять строку на подстроки, основываясь на определенном разделителе.
Пример использования функции сплит очень прост: допустим, у нас есть строка, которая содержит список элементов, разделенных запятой. Используя сплит, мы можем разделить эту строку на отдельные элементы и сохранить их в массиве для дальнейшей обработки. Такая функциональность очень удобна, например, для работы с данными, полученными из форм или файлов.
Практическое применение сплита в различных областях программирования также очень широко. В веб-разработке он может использоваться для разбора URL, извлечения параметров запроса или получения имени файла из пути. В анализе данных сплит может быть полезен для преобразования структурированных данных в более удобный формат, например, для решения задач классификации или кластеризации.
- Роль сплитов в анализе данных
- Как работает сплит: основные принципы
- Практическое применение сплитов в бизнесе
- Важность правильной настройки сплитов
- Вопрос-ответ
- Зачем использовать сплит в программировании?
- Как использовать сплит в Python для разделения строки по разделителю?
- Можно ли разделить строку на несколько подстрок с использованием сплита в Java?
- Каким образом сплит может помочь при обработке файла?
- Каким образом сплит может быть использован для обработки данных в базе данных?
- В чем разница между сплитом и регулярными выражениями?
Роль сплитов в анализе данных
Сплиты являются важным инструментом в анализе данных и используются для разделения данных на отдельные группы или подмножества. Это дает возможность проводить сравнительный анализ и измерять эффективность различных вариантов или действий.
Одним из типичных применений сплитов в анализе данных является A/B-тестирование. При проведении A/B-теста данные разделяются на две случайно выбранные группы: контрольную группу (A) и экспериментальную группу (B). Контрольная группа остается без изменений и используется в качестве базовой линии для сравнения, а экспериментальной группе применяется изменение или воздействие. Затем анализируются результаты и сравниваются показатели контрольной и экспериментальной группы, чтобы определить, какое из изменений оказало наибольшее влияние.
Сплиты также могут использоваться для проведения мультитестов, когда данные разделяются на три и более группы. Это позволяет сравнивать несколько вариантов одновременно и выявлять наиболее эффективные решения или стратегии.
Кроме того, сплиты могут быть полезны при разделении данных для проведения предсказательного анализа. Например, можно разделить данные на тренировочную и тестовую выборки, чтобы обучить модель на тренировочных данных и проверить ее производительность на тестовых данных.
Для создания сплитов данные могут быть рандомизированы или разделены на основе определенных критериев или переменных. Для достоверных результатов важно, чтобы сплиты были случайными и репрезентативными для исходной выборки.
В заключение, сплиты играют важную роль в анализе данных, позволяя проводить сравнительные исследования, определять эффективность и проводить предсказательный анализ. Они являются фундаментальным инструментом для принятия обоснованных решений на основе данных.
Как работает сплит: основные принципы
Сплит — это метод, который позволяет разделить трафик между разными версиями веб-сайта или приложения, чтобы определить, какая из них работает лучше для достижения поставленных целей. В основе сплит-тестирования лежит сравнение различных вариантов элементов интерфейса или контента, чтобы выявить наиболее эффективный.
Основные принципы работы сплит-тестирования выглядят следующим образом:
- Выбор параметров для тестирования: Перед началом сплит-тестирования необходимо определить, какие параметры будут меняться. Это могут быть заголовки, текст, изображения, цвета, расположение элементов и т. д.
- Создание вариантов: На основе выбранных параметров создаются разные варианты страницы или элемента.
- Разделение трафика: Сплит-тестирование проводится на выборке пользователей, которые случайным образом распределяются между разными вариантами.
- Сбор данных: Во время проведения теста собираются данные о поведении пользователей, например, конверсиях, кликах, времени на странице и т. д.
- Анализ результатов: После завершения теста производится анализ собранных данных для определения самого эффективного варианта.
- Применение результатов: Выбранный вариант, который оказался наиболее успешным, применяется на основной аудитории.
С помощью сплит-тестирования можно оптимизировать различные аспекты веб-сайта или приложения, улучшить пользовательский опыт, повысить конверсию и достичь других поставленных целей. Этот метод позволяет принимать решения на основе данных и достичь оптимальных результатов.
Практическое применение сплитов в бизнесе
Сплит-тестирование является одним из ключевых инструментов в анализе эффективности веб-сайта или приложения. Благодаря сплитам бизнесы могут оптимизировать свои сайты, улучшая пользовательский опыт и повышая конверсию.
Вот несколько практических применений сплитов в бизнесе:
- Тестирование различных версий дизайна — одно из самых популярных применений сплит-тестирования. Бизнесы могут создавать разные варианты дизайна сайта или приложения и тестировать их на реальных пользователях. Это помогает выявить оптимальный дизайн, который приводит к увеличению конверсии.
- Изучение влияния контента на пользователей — сплит-тестирование позволяет бизнесам проверять различные варианты контента, такие как заголовки, описания или цвета текста. Благодаря этому можно определить, какой вариант контента наиболее привлекает и удерживает внимание пользователей, что помогает улучшить их вовлеченность и конверсию.
- Оптимизация цен и скидок — сплит-тестирование может быть использовано для определения оптимальной цены или скидки. Путем тестирования разных вариантов ценовой политики бизнесы могут выяснить, какие цены наиболее привлекательны для пользователей и стимулируют их к покупке.
- Тестирование различных шагов воронки продаж — сплит-тестирование может быть использовано для оптимизации каждого шага воронки продаж. Бизнесы могут тестировать различные варианты страниц заказа или регистрации, чтобы найти самые эффективные варианты для увеличения конверсии и снижения отказов.
- Улучшение производительности сайта или приложения — сплит-тестирование можно использовать для проверки различных вариантов оптимизации сайта или приложения. Бизнесы могут тестировать разные варианты загрузки, скорости работы или взаимодействия пользователей с интерфейсом с целью улучшить пользовательский опыт.
Все эти практические применения сплитов позволяют бизнесам добиться лучших результатов, повысить эффективность своих веб-ресурсов и удовлетворить потребности своих клиентов. Сплит-тестирование становится неотъемлемой частью стратегии многих успешных бизнесов и позволяет им оставаться конкурентоспособными на рынке.
Важность правильной настройки сплитов
Настройка сплитов является одним из важных элементов успешной работы с тестированием и оптимизацией веб-сайтов. Правильная настройка сплитов позволяет провести эксперименты, сравнивать разные варианты контента, дизайна или функционала сайта и определить наиболее эффективные решения на основе данных и статистики.
Ошибки или неправильная настройка сплитов могут привести к некорректным результатам экспериментов и вводу в заблуждение при определении наиболее эффективных вариантов. Это может привести к неправильным решениям и упущению возможностей для оптимизации и улучшения сайта.
Правильная настройка сплитов также помогает избежать проблем с долгим временем загрузки или ошибками в работе сайта при одновременном тестировании нескольких вариантов контента. Оптимальное использование ресурсов и настройка правил для разделения трафика позволяют проводить эксперименты без воздействия на работу основного сайта и пользовательского опыта.
Для правильной настройки сплитов необходимо учитывать различные факторы, такие как объем трафика, размер выборки, длительность эксперимента и статистическая достоверность результатов. Также важно определить цели и метрики, которые будут использоваться для оценки эффективности тестируемых вариантов и принятия решений.
Правильно настроенные сплиты позволяют получить надежные и достоверные результаты, которые можно использовать для оптимизации веб-сайта и улучшения пользовательского опыта. Они также помогают избежать необоснованных изменений и принимать решения на основе данных и фактов, а не на интуиции или предположениях.
Вопрос-ответ
Зачем использовать сплит в программировании?
Сплит — это функция в программировании, которая разделяет строку на подстроки с использованием разделителя. Она используется для обработки текстовых данных, разделения строк на слова, разбиения текста на абзацы и других подобных задач.
Как использовать сплит в Python для разделения строки по разделителю?
В Python сплит используется с помощью метода split(), который вызывается на строке. Например, если у вас есть строка «Hello, World!», и вы хотите разделить ее по запятой, вы можете использовать следующий код: «Hello, World!».split(«,»)
Можно ли разделить строку на несколько подстрок с использованием сплита в Java?
Да, в Java также есть метод split() для разделения строк на подстроки. Например, если у вас есть строка «Привет, мир!», и вы хотите разделить ее по пробелу, вы можете использовать следующий код: «Привет, мир!».split(» «)
Каким образом сплит может помочь при обработке файла?
При обработке файла сплит может быть полезен для разбиения текста на строки или подстроки, а также для извлечения определенной информации из текстового файла. Например, вы можете использовать сплит для разделения CSV-файла по запятой и извлечения данных из определенных столбцов.
Каким образом сплит может быть использован для обработки данных в базе данных?
В базе данных сплит может быть использован для разделения значения поля на отдельные элементы данных. Например, если у вас есть поле «Имя, Фамилия» в таблице с именами пользователей, вы можете использовать сплит для разделения этого поля на две отдельные колонки «Имя» и «Фамилия» для более удобной обработки.
В чем разница между сплитом и регулярными выражениями?
Сущность сплита заключается в разделении строки на подстроки с использованием заданного разделителя, в то время как регулярные выражения позволяют выполнять более сложные операции с текстом, такие как поиск и замена определенных паттернов. Регулярные выражения обладают большей гибкостью и функциональностью, но требуют более сложного синтаксиса и могут быть медленнее в выполнении.